首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Xcode 11中分组时无法创建类的实例

在Xcode 11中,分组是一种将项目中的文件组织起来的方式,但是分组并不会直接影响类的实例化。类的实例化是通过代码来完成的,而不是通过Xcode的分组功能。

要在Xcode 11中创建类的实例,可以按照以下步骤进行操作:

  1. 打开Xcode 11,并创建一个新的项目或打开现有的项目。
  2. 在项目导航器中,找到你想要创建类的位置。你可以选择将类文件放在项目的根目录或者某个子目录下。
  3. 右键点击所选位置,选择"New File"(新建文件)。
  4. 在弹出的对话框中,选择"Swift File"(Swift文件)或"Objective-C File"(Objective-C文件),然后点击"Next"(下一步)。
  5. 输入文件名,并点击"Create"(创建)。
  6. Xcode会自动为你创建一个新的类文件,并打开该文件进行编辑。
  7. 在类文件中,你可以定义类的属性、方法和初始化函数等。
  8. 要创建类的实例,可以在其他代码文件中引用该类,并使用类名加上括号的方式来实例化对象。例如,在Swift中,可以使用以下代码创建一个类的实例:
代码语言:txt
复制
let myObject = MyClass()

在这个例子中,MyClass是你创建的类的名称,myObject是你创建的类的实例。

需要注意的是,Xcode的分组功能只是用来组织项目文件的可视化方式,并不会直接影响类的实例化。类的实例化是通过代码来完成的,与项目文件的组织方式无关。

关于Xcode 11和类的实例化的更多信息,你可以参考腾讯云的开发者文档中与Xcode和Swift相关的内容:

希望以上信息对你有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共17个视频
动力节点-JDK动态代理(AOP)使用及实现原理分析
动力节点Java培训
动态代理是使用jdk的反射机制,创建对象的能力, 创建的是代理类的对象。 而不用你创建类文件。不用写java文件。 动态:在程序执行时,调用jdk提供的方法才能创建代理类的对象。jdk动态代理,必须有接口,目标类必须实现接口, 没有接口时,需要使用cglib动态代理。 动态代理可以在不改变原来目标方法功能的前提下, 可以在代理中增强自己的功能代码。
领券